Citrus Salad

Serves: 1

Total Time: 10 min


Fresh, sweet and delicious. This simple salad is for those who don’t always want the leafy greens because sometimes it can be nice to switch it up.

Ingredients

¼ cup olive oil

2 tbs red wine vinegar

1 tbs honey

1 large naval orange

1 large satsuma

1 large grapefruit

Salt & pepper to taste

Mint, to garnish

Basil, to garnish


  1. Peel by cutting the top and bottom off each fruit and then slice the rest of the peel off, making sure to cut close to the fruit as possible. This technique is called supreming. You can also cut it however you feel is easiest, but this way can be fun.

  2. Plate the segments of fruit onto a plate or bowl.

  3. Mix the olive oil, red wine vinegar, honey, and salt and pepper together. Drizzle as much dressing as you’d like over your salad.

  4. Roll up a few pieces of basil and mint, slice thinly (chiffonade) and garnish as desired.

  5. Enjoy!
